Casework involving EIOs and EAWs in 2020

Judicial tools New cases in 2020 Ongoing from previous years Total
European Investigation Order (EIO) 1772 1387 3159
European Arrest Warrant (EAW) 572 712 1284

Casework, meetings and joint activities in the priority crime areas, 2017-2020

Crime types Cases* Coordination meetings Joint investigation teams** Coordination centres / action days
2017 2018 2019 2020 2017 2018 2019 2020 2017 2018 2019 2020 2017 2018 2019 2020
Terrorism 177 190 222 217 14 20 24 12 13 12 8 7 1 - - -
Cybercrime 176 218 247 334 9 28 35 45 7 10 17 21 1 2 3 1
Migrant smuggling 153 157 187 217 15 17 24 21 14 12 12 12 2 3 2 2
Swindling and fraud 1630 1924 2262 2647 75 87 112 91 46 50 65 68 7 7 12 8
Money laudering 858 1041 1265 1460 86 94 138 101 44 49 72 64 5 6 6 7
Drug trafficking 719 896 1003 1169 40 78 80 87 29 42 51 50 4 - 2 4
Trafficking in human beings 287 343 399 397 57 43 54 56 51 56 61 48 - - 4 2
Crimes against the financial interests of the EU (PIF crimes) 127 137 228 286 13 9 15 20 5 8 11 10 3 1 2 2
Environmental crime 19 38 41 51 3 6 8 6 2 4 6 6 1 - 1 -
Corruption 197 222 250 286 15 19 14 8 4 6 5 5 1 - - -
Mobile organised crime groups 482 541 598 721 14 26 20 19 13 15 17 13 - 1 2 1
Core international crimes - - - 12 - - - 2 - - - - - - - -

* Sum of new cases and ongoing cases from previous years: The data contained in this table were extracted from Eurojust's Case Management System in February 2021. Due to the ongoing nature of cases, possible discrepancies with previously reported numbers may exist, and statistics may be updated in the future.

** Sum of newly established JITs and ongoing JITs from previous years
